Muse show
Venue Grand Place[source?]
Date 1st July 2006[source?]
Location Arras[source?]
Country France
Songs 16[source?]
Support The Kooks, Second Sex[source?]
Start Unknown
Capacity Unknown
Price Unknown
Sold out? Unknown


Thomas Kirk said that Showbiz was played especially because this was the first French gig on the Black Holes and Revelations tour.[source?]
